Seaplane pilots and aviation enthusiasts from across the region will gather this September for the 2026 Minnesota Seaplane Pilots Association (MSPA) September Safety Seminar, an annual event combining aviation education, safety, and plenty of seaplane fun.
The weekend will feature a spectacular seaplane fly-in, educational and safety seminars, more than 20 aviation-related vendors, and opportunities to connect with fellow pilots and aviation professionals.
Among this year’s featured speakers is Bruno Brasileiro Ferreira, known to his followers as @FlyWithBruno. Ferreira shares his aviation adventures and challenges while flying his 1978 Grumman AA5B Tiger through YouTube, Instagram, and TikTok.
The event gets underway Friday afternoon with a Seaplane Ground School led by Mark Cook, FAAST Team Representative. The ground school is free to attend and offers pilots an opportunity to sharpen their knowledge while preparing for the weekend’s activities. Friday evening continues with a social hour and buffet dinner.
Saturday will feature an accuracy landing contest, followed by a banquet dinner. Attendees can also participate in a silent auction and prize drawing, adding to the weekend’s social atmosphere.
